In a mass spectrometer, a singly ionized 24Mg ion has a mass equal to 3.983 10-26 kg and is accelerated through a 3.00-kV potential difference. It then enters a region where it is deflected by a magnetic field of 526 G. Find the radius of curvature of the ion's orbit. Note: There are 10,000 G in 1 T and 1,000 V in 1 kV.
